Abstract

The utility model relates to a pneumatic two-position four-way slide valve, relating to a pneumatic control device used in an industrial production process. The pneumatic two-position four-way slide valve comprises a piston type actuating mechanism and a valve body assembly. The piston type actuating mechanism comprises a cylinder, a piston, a sealing ring, a pressing plate, a fastening screw, a compression spring and a bracket, the valve body assembly comprises a valve body, a valve stem, sealing rings, valve cores and the piston, the valve body is provided with an input port, two output ports and an emptying port, and the position of the valve stem can be controlled so that the input port is communicated with one output port, and the other output port is communicated with the emptying port for emptying. The pneumatic two-position four-way slide valve has a high switching speed and long service life, leakage cannot be caused easily, the accuracy of switching control of working medium delivery or emptying can be improved, and the automation of process control can be facilitated.

Description

The Pneumatic two-position four-way guiding valve
Technical field
The utility model relates to the air control unit in the industrial processes, realizes the switching of working medium (liquid or gas) is carried or switched the Pneumatic two-position four-way guiding valve of emptying in particularly a kind of industrial processes.
Background technique
Often need realize to switch carry or switch emptying in the modern industry production process working medium, and the fast and control accuracy that is related to slowly in the process control the working medium amount of its switch speed.Have only the sluggish problem that solves switch speed, could realize automation process control well, improve the control accuracy and to the adaptation of technological requirement to reach.There is following defective in existing technology: the pneumatic actuator that 1. has homemade Pneumatic two-position four-way guiding valve now all adopts diaphragm actuator; Because diaphragm is to be processed by the rubber material; There are insufficient strength and easy problem of aging; Therefore in use need frequent repair and replacement, this can influence industrial efficient and increase cost of production; 2. the valve rod that has homemade Pneumatic two-position four-way guiding valve now no longer carries out the hard chromium plating surface treatment after no longer finish grinding or finish grind after the Vehicle Processing, its roughness grade is not high, is easy to make the interior seal ring generation of valve body to cut phenomenon and causes leaking; The action sensitivity of 4. existing Pneumatic two-position four-way guiding valve is low, and switch speed is slow; During the two-way control of 5. existing Pneumatic two-position four-way guiding valve, need with two air bladder final controlling element, volume is big, and consumptive material is many, increase cost of production expense.Drawbacks such as in sum, existing homemade Pneumatic two-position four-way guiding valve exists switch speed slow, be prone to leak, and working life is long, influence be to the control accuracy of working medium amount, the automatic control requirement in can not the well adapted process control system.
The model utility content
For solving the problem that exists in the existing technology; The utility model aims to provide fast, the long service life of a kind of switch speed; Antileakaging Pneumatic two-position four-way guiding valve can improve working medium is switched the control accuracy of carrying or switching emptying, is convenient to the automation control of process control.
Described Pneumatic two-position four-way guiding valve comprises piston actuator and valve body assembly; Wherein, Described piston actuator comprises cylinder, piston, seal ring, pressing plate, fastening screw trip bolt, pressure spring and support; Said seal ring is fixed on the piston through pressing plate, fastening screw trip bolt, and cylinder is integral through being threaded with support, and pressure spring is placed on piston and props up in the inner chamber that is configured to; Reset when being used to a definite gas control signal value and unidirectional control are provided, respectively be provided with a gas control signal inlet opening on cylinder and the support; Described valve body assembly comprises the valve body that is connected with support, cooperates in this valve body to be provided with valve rod, seal ring and spool, and valve rod and piston link into an integrated entity, and seal ring is fixed on the spool; Valve body is provided with an inlet opening, two delivery outlets and an evacuation port, and the position through the control valve rod can make inlet opening to delivery outlet communicate, the emptying of another delivery outlet to evacuation port; Perhaps the inlet opening communicates to another delivery outlet, the emptying of delivery outlet to evacuation port.
Described Pneumatic two-position four-way guiding valve wherein, is provided with circular groove in the middle of the described seal ring, is provided with counterbalance spring in this circular groove.
Described Pneumatic two-position four-way guiding valve, wherein, the seal ring in the said valve body assembly is provided with five, and spool is provided with four.
Owing to have said structure, make to the utlity model has following effect:
One, owing to the utlity model has long working life, safe and reliable sealability can reduce maintenance rate, improves commercial production efficient, reduces production costs;
Two, because the utility model is carried the switching of working medium or the switching intestine evacuation velocity is fast, can satisfy the technological requirement in the industrial processes preferably, improve the control accuracy.

Embodiment
Combine Figure of description at present, specify a preferred embodiment of the utility model.
Pneumatic two-position four-way guiding valve referring to shown in Figure 1 comprises piston actuator and valve body assembly; Wherein, Described piston actuator comprises cylinder 1, piston 2, seal ring 4, counterbalance spring 3, pressing plate 5, fastening screw trip bolt 6, pressure spring 7 and support 8; Said seal ring 4 is fixed on the piston 2 through pressing plate 5, fastening screw trip bolt 6, is provided with circular groove in the middle of the described seal ring 4, is provided with counterbalance spring 3 in this circular groove; Cylinder 1 is integral through being threaded with support 8; Pressure spring 7 is placed in the inner chamber of piston 2 and support 8 formations, resets when being used to a definite gas control signal value and unidirectional control are provided, and respectively is provided with a gas control signal inlet opening on cylinder 1 and the support 8; Described valve body assembly comprises valve body 9; Valve body 9 is connected with support 8 through last attachment screw 15; Cooperate in this valve body 9 to be provided with valve rod 10, five valve seals 13 and four spools 14, valve rod 10 links into an integrated entity with piston 2, and valve seals 13 is separately fixed on the spool 14; Valve body 9 also comprises the bottom warp valve gap 11 of attachment screw 12 connections down; Valve body 9 is provided with an inlet opening (being positioned at the front of valve body shown in Figure 1), and two delivery outlet A, B and evacuation port O are when the gas control signal is imported in the inlet opening of cylinder 1; The pretightening force that overcomes pressure spring 7 makes piston 2 drive valve rods 10 and moves downward the inlet opening is communicated to delivery outlet A; Delivery outlet B is to evacuation port O emptying, during unidirectional control, stops the gas control signal of cylinder 1; Rely on the elastic potential energy of pressure spring 7 to make valve reset and the inlet opening is communicated to delivery outlet B, delivery outlet A is to evacuation port O emptying; During two-way control; Stop the gas control signal of cylinder 1; At the inlet opening of support 8 input gas control signal piston drive valve rod is moved upward the inlet opening is communicated to delivery outlet B, delivery outlet A so works circularly and realizes that switching is carried or the function of switching emptying to evacuation port O emptying.
